    The roads on Colonial Boulevard are notorious for congestion and crashes, but there might be hope on the horizon. WINK News anchor Chris Cifatte investigated the area’s traffic troubles and discovered plans to improve conditions. Officer Ryan Hernandez Beiner of the Fort Myers Police Department is committed to making the roads safer. WINK News had the opportunity to join him on a ride-along, witnessing firsthand the challenges on Colonial Boulevard. Part of the problem is volume.

    Naples is turning to technology to tackle traffic troubles. Naples Police Chief Ciro Dominguez revealed the tech strategies for keeping roads clear. “Our traffic units concentrate in certain areas that we know they’re above normal congestion,” said Naples PD. Chief Dominguez explained that cell phones contribute to real-time traffic data, aiding police in identifying congested roads. “You usually have about 200,000 vehicles in the city in a 24-hour period,” said the Naples Police Chief.
